JX-B5C 应用场景与项目 FAQ¶
本页用于整理 JX-B5C 相关的应用场景与项目问题。
音箱播放音乐时无法识别语音怎么办?¶
问题描述:
使用语音模块开发音箱产品时,遇到播放音乐时无法识别语音指令的问题: - 功放声音较大(如3W)时,播放音乐过程中语音唤醒无反应 - 不播放音乐或调低音量后,语音识别恢复正常 - 询问是否有支持矩阵麦克风的方案
原因分析:
这是典型的回声干扰问题: - 设备自身播放的声音会被麦克风拾取 - 播放音量越大,对语音识别的干扰越严重 - 不支持AEC(声学回声消除)功能的模块无法有效抑制回声
解决方案:使用 JX-B5C 模块
JX-B5C 是二合一模组,专门针对蓝牙音箱场景设计:
| 功能特性 | 说明 |
|---|---|
| 离线语音识别 | 基于CI1302芯片,支持本地语音唤醒和命令词识别 |
| 蓝牙音乐播放 | 集成蜂鸟B芯片,支持A2DP蓝牙音乐播放 |
| AEC回声消除 | 支持声学回声消除,播放音乐时可识别语音 |
| 语音打断 | 播放音乐时可以通过唤醒词打断并识别新指令 |
应用优势:
- 真正的二合一集成:单模组同时支持语音和蓝牙音乐,无需额外模块
- 支持打断功能:播放音乐时说出唤醒词即可打断并识别新指令
- 高性价比:相比使用多个模块组合,成本更优
注意事项:
- JX-B5C2 IO引脚较少(仅TX/RX),如需连接物理按键可考虑SU-63T
- 使用AEC功能时需按照规格书正确连接麦克风和扬声器
- 详细文档参考:JX-B5C 官方文档